TSPSC Group 3 Selection Process 2026

The TSPSC Group 3 selection process consists of two primary stages: an Offline Written Examination and a Personal Interview. Candidates who qualify for the written test will be invited for the interview in a 1:2 ratio based on the total number of vacancies. The final merit list is determined by the cumulative marks secured in both the written examination and the interview.

TSPSC Group 3 Exam Pattern 2026

The TSPSC Group 3 examination comprises three papers: Paper 1, Paper 2, and Paper 3. Each paper consists of 150 objective-type questions carrying 1 mark each, with an allotted time of 150 minutes per paper. The exam is administered in three languages: English, Telugu, and Urdu. TSPSC Group 3 Syllabus 2026

The TSPSC Group 3 structure is divided into the following three papers:

Paper I – General Studies and General Abilities

Paper-II – History, Political Science, and Society

Paper-III – Economy and Development

PaperTSPSC Group III Syllabus
Paper IGeneral Studies and General Abilities
  1. World Geography
  2. Indian Geography
  3. Telangana State Geography
  4. Cultural Heritage and History of India
  5. Social Exclusion
  6. Rights Issues
  7. Inclusive policies
  8. Policies of the State of Telangana
  9. Basic English (up to 8th grade)
  10. Regional Current Affairs
  11. National Current Affairs
  12. International Current Affairs
  13. General Science: India’s Technology
  14. Society, Heritage, Literature, Arts, and Cultures of Telangana
  15. Logical Reasoning: Data Interpretation and Analytical ability
  16. Disaster Management: Prevention and Mitigation strategies, Environmental Concerns
  17. International Events and Relations
Paper-IIHistory, Political Science, and Society
  1. Socio-Cultural characteristics of Society in Telangana
  2. Remarkable features of Indian Society: Caste, Religion, Tribe, Marriage, Family
  3. Social Issues: Communalism, Casteism, Child labor, Violence against women, Disability
  4. Social Movements: Women’s Movements, Dalit Movements, Peasant’s movement, Environmental Movements, Human Rights Movements.
  5. Social issues of Telangana: Child Labour, Fluorosis, Girl Child, Vetti, Jogini, Migration, and Framer’s and weaver’s labor.
  6. Welfare Programmes
  7. Employment, Rural and urban, Tribal welfare, Poverty Alleviation
Paper IIIEconomy and Development
Issues and challenges of Indian Economy
Enhancement and Outgrowth: Relationship between growth and enhancement and Concepts
Economic Growth measurement: Definition, concepts of Natural Income, Real and nominal income
Poverty and unemployment: Measurement of Poverty, Definition and types of unemployment
Planning in Indian Economy: Priorities, Objectives, achievements, and strategies of five-year plans.
Issues of Developments and change: Sustainable Development and goals, Concepts and Measurement
Displacement and Development: Land Acquisition Policy, Rehabilitation and Resettlement
Economic Reforms: Inequalities, Growth, and Poverty, Social security, Social Transformation
Sustainable Development: Sustainable Development Goals, Concept and Measurement of Development
